Recently, 163 has revealed the secrets of the casting process for the upcoming film adaptation of The Legend of the Condor Heroes from 2006. At the time, participating in a martial arts work based on Jin Yong’s novels was a significant opportunity for any actor.
According to 163, the talented actor Daniel Chan was chosen by the producers to portray the character Yang Guo. At that time, Daniel Chan was a highly sought-after star, well-known far beyond the Hong Kong film industry. With his handsome appearance and charismatic charm, he bears a striking resemblance to the character Yang Guo. Born in 1980, he recently made headlines with his role in the film New Police Story.


Beyond his looks, Daniel Chan’s performance has been highly rated compared to other popular actors like Huynh Hieu Minh and Nhiem Vien. His unique angle and masculine demeanor have made him a favorite among audiences. Furthermore, celebrities such as Dương Mịch, Trương Bá Chi, and the beauty queen Vương Phi have shown admiration for Daniel Chan’s talent.
However, when the film crew reached out to Daniel Chan, the management company imposed a restriction that he could only participate in the film for 40 days. At that time, his schedule was packed. The production house even suggested filming exclusively for Daniel Chan to expedite the process, accommodating his busy schedule.
In the end, both sides could not reach a satisfactory agreement as Daniel Chan was not only looking for quick filming but also sought a fee that was too high, causing the production team to reconsider their plans.
